During the autumn, all red deer subspecies grow thicker coats of hair, which helps to insulate them during the winter. Reintroduction and conservation efforts, such as in the United Kingdom and Portugal,[7] have resulted in an increase of red deer populations, while other areas, such as North Africa, have continued to show a population decline. Male deer of all subspecies, however, tend to have stronger and thicker neck muscles than female deer, which may give them an appearance of having neck manes.
